Question:

Consider the isomers of hydrocarbon with molecular formula \(C_5H_{10}\). These isomers do not decolourise \(KMnO_4\) solution. These isomers are subjected to chlorination with chlorine in presence of light to give monochloro compounds. The total number of monochloro compounds (structural isomers only) formed is ______.}

Correct Answer: 8

Solution and Explanation

Concept: If \(C_5H_{10}\) does not decolourise \(KMnO_4\), it must be a cycloalkane. Possible cycloalkane isomers:
  • Cyclopentane
  • Methylcyclobutane
  • Ethylcyclopropane
  • Dimethylcyclopropane

Step 1:Monochloro derivatives}
  • Cyclopentane → 1
  • Methylcyclobutane → 3
  • Ethylcyclopropane → 3
  • Dimethylcyclopropane → 1

Step 2:Total} \[ 1 + 3 + 3 + 1 = 8 \] \[ \boxed{8} \]
